			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>The incestuous relationship between Mercedes-AMG and Ducati continues as the brands stage a joint appearance at the Bologna Motor Show, starting this Friday. </p>
<p>The new SLK 55 AMG and the Ducati Streetfighter 848 – both finished in &#8220;Streetfighter yellow&#8221; – are to go on show and underscore the collaboration entered into by their parent companies just over a year ago.</p>
<p>Inspired by the Ducati Streetfighter 848, the &#8220;streetfighter yellow&#8221; colour could be made available as an individual optional extra from the AMG Performance Studio, for AMG customers who feel the need to stand out.  </p>
<p>Complemented by the interior of the SLK 55 AMG: the contrasting yellow stitching creates a striking effect against the black nappa leather, and is found on the door centre panels, beltlines, armrests, leather-covered roll-over bars, dashboard, the shift lever gaiter and also the AMG Performance steering wheel. Yellow illuminated AMG door sill panels featuring LED technology round off the striking, erm.. <em>yellow</em> effect.</p>
<p><img src="http://skiddmark.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/11/ducati-AMG-streetfighter_I1.jpg" alt="Ducati Streetfighter 848 and Mercedes-AMG SLK55" /></p>
<p>Powered by its newly developed AMG 5.5-litre naturally aspirated V8 engine, the SLK55 harnesses 416 bhp and maximum toque of 540 Nm, whilst delivering 33.6 mpg on the combined cycle and 195g/km of CO2 emissions &#8211; some 30 percent better that its predecessor. The SLK 55 AMG accelerates from 0-62 mph in just 4.6 seconds, and reaches a top speed of 155 mph (electronically limited). </p>
<p>The new Ducati Streetfighter 848 provides aims to provide biking pleasure in its purest form, while combining the very latest technologies with a dramatically styled appearance.  Using a revised 848 Testastretta 11° engine with 130 bhp and 93.5 Nm of torque, the Streetfighter 848 is at home whether on the road or on the race track.  </p>
<h2>Mercedes-AMG and Ducati &#8211; one year on</h2>
<p>Since the agreement was signed between Mercedes-AMG and Ducati at the Los Angeles Motor Show in November 2010, both companies have been integrating their brands through a series of joint marketing activities.</p>
<p>AMG has been the &#8220;Official Car Partner&#8221; of the Ducati MotoGP team since the start of the 2011 MotoGP season, whilst the AMG logo appears not only on the motorcycles and racing overalls of Ducati works drivers Nicky Hayden and Valentino Rossi, but also on the official team wear and in the Ducati Lounge. </p>
<p>Ducati&#8217;s fleet of company vehicles is being gradually switched over to Mercedes-Benz whilst there are more marketing and joint-technology developments on the way.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>After we reported earlier in the week that Audi&#8217;s 2011 DTM Champion, Martin Tomczyk had left the Ingolstadt team, BMW has announced this morning that the 29-year old German driver will join Andy Priaulx, Augusto Farfus and Bruno Spengler in driving the M3 DTM in 2012.  </p>
<p>It&#8217;s a major coup for BMW, not only because Tomczyk was one of Audi&#8217;s quickest drivers, but he brings with him the coveted No. 1.</p>
<p>“Our squad of drivers is gradually firming up,” said BMW Motorsport Director Jens Marquardt. “With Martin Tomczyk we are proud to have gained an absolute top-notch driver for our DTM involvement. Despite being fairly young in the touring car context, he is one of the most experienced DTM drivers around: he’s consistently fast, of impeccable character and an out-and-out winner. </p>
<p><img src="http://www.skiddmark.com/wp-content/uploads/2005/10/Tomczyk-BMW_I2.jpg" alt="BMW M3 DTM testing at Monteblanco" /></p>
<p>In 2011 he was the first driver ever to win the DTM championship in an older spec car. We will do everything we can to consolidate this success with him in the future. Our target is to become competitive as quickly as possible, and from that point of view we see Martin as an extremely important asset.”</p>
<p>After several years in karting, 1998 and 1999 saw Tomczyk compete in the BMW Formula ADAC junior racing series initiated by the ADAC and BMW. Following a year in Formula 3, he took the step up into the DTM, where he has been driving for Audi since the 2001 season. In 2007 and 2011 Tomczyk was voted ADAC Motor Sportsman of the Year. </p>
<p>The highlight of his career so far came this season, in which he celebrated three out of his total of seven DTM wins, made it onto the podium eight times, and became the first driver in DTM history to take the title in an older spec car.</p>
<p><img src="http://www.skiddmark.com/wp-content/uploads/2005/10/Tomczyk-BMW_I1.jpg" alt="BMW M3 DTM testing at Monteblanco" /></p>
<p>From 6th to 8th December, Tomczyk will get behind the wheel of the BMW M3 DTM for the first time in Monteblanco, southern Spain. </p>
<p>With three BMW factory teams gearing up for the 2012 season, there are now just 2 seats available.  </p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>There&#8217;s an interesting story coming out of Audi Motorsport this morning confirming that their newly-crowned DTM champion, Martin Tomczyk, has left the Ingolstadt brand by mutual agreement.  Tomczyk has been a factory driver for Audi since the 2001 season and at 19-years old was the youngest ever DTM driver at the time.</p>
<p>There is no word (as yet) where Tomczyk will next appear, BMW are evaluating drivers for its 3-car entry in the 2012 DTM season and have so far confirmed just 3 of their 6 drivers (Augusto Farfus, Andy Priaulx and Bruno Spengler).</p>
<p>Tomczyk describes his decision as a difficult one that he made only after careful consideration.  &#8220;I won the Championship for Audi after eleven years together. The entire Audi Sport team and in particular Dr. Wolfgang Ullrich have always been behind me throughout the many years we spent together,&#8221; explains Tomczyk. </p>
<p>&#8220;I’m delighted that I could repay the trust by winning the 2011 championship title together with team Phoenix. Despite this joint success, and after careful consideration, I have now decided to accept a new challenge. To conclude, I would once again like to thank everybody with whom I have worked together during my eleven years at Audi Sport and assure every single individual that these years were, in hindsight, something very special.&#8221; </p>
<p><img src="http://www.skiddmark.com/wp-content/uploads/2005/10/Tomczyk-audi_I1.jpg" alt="Martin Tomczyk - 2011 DTM Champion for Audi Motorsports" /></p>
<p>Tomczyk started his DTM career in the 2001 season as 19-year-old in Team ABT Sportsline with the Abt-Audi TT-R and was, at that time, the youngest DTM driver in history. In 2003 he became Audi factory driver in the ‘S line Audi Junior Team.’ Since 2004 he has competed with the Audi A4 in the DTM, initially for Audi Sport Team Abt Sportsline and for the first time in 2011 for Audi Sport Team Phoenix. </p>
<p>In his sixth DTM season in 2006 he finally recorded the first of his seven DTM race wins to date. By winning the championship title in 2011 at the wheel of a year-old car he achieved the greatest victory of his career up to now. </p>
<p>His country&#8217;s motor sport federation Allgemeiner Deutscher Automobil-Club (ADAC) awarded the DTM champion the title of &#8216;Motor Sportsman of the Year&#8217; ahead of his compatriot and F1 champion Sebastian Vettel.  Tomczyk&#8217;s father, Hermann, is Sporting President of the ADAC. </p>
<p>&#8220;It goes without saying that we deeply regret that he decided, at this moment in time, to seek a new challenge after his most successful DTM season with Audi,&#8221; says Head of Audi Motorsport Dr. Wolfgang Ullrich. &#8220;I can, however, completely understand that after eleven special years of highs and lows with Audi he would like to try something new &#8211; after all by winning the DTM title at the wheel of an Audi A4 DTM he has achieved exactly the goal for which he was worked so hard for many years. </p>
<p>I’m personally delighted that Martin showed his many critics this year because I always believed in him. I can understand that to start he viewed the transfer to team Phoenix and a year-old car as demotion. But it gave, as I hoped, his career new impulses. I always enjoyed working together with Martin. He is a complete professional who I personally hold in high regard. I wish him all the best for the future.&#8221; </p>
<p>How Audi will line up in the DTM next year will be decided over the forthcoming weeks. In Mattias Ekström (Sweden) and Timo Scheider (Germany) the Ingolstadt brand has two DTM Champions under contract who have both won the championship twice for Audi. No less than eight of the nine Audi drivers mounted the DTM podium at least once in 2011.  Audi currently plans to contest the DTM 2012 with a maximum of seven cars.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>The long-running saga between Group Lotus and Tony Fernandes&#8217; 1Malaysia Racing Team has been brought to an amicable conclusion.  In a joint-statement released earlier this morning, Proton, Group Lotus, 1Malaysia Racing Team and its owner Tony Fernandes announced that the legal dispute in the English Courts relating to the &#8220;LOTUS&#8221; and &#8220;TEAM LOTUS&#8221; brands had now ended with the parties agreeing settlement terms earlier this month.</p>
<p>The terms of the settlement are confidential but the deal sees the &#8220;LOTUS&#8221; brand reunited under the sole ownership of Group Lotus. This includes the rights to the &#8220;LOTUS&#8221; and &#8220;TEAM LOTUS&#8221; names in Formula 1 motor racing.</p>
<p>1MRT will race in the 2012 Formula 1 season under the name &#8220;CATERHAM F1 TEAM&#8221; and will use a “CATERHAM” chassis.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Mercedes DTM lead driver, Bruno Spengler, has left the Stuttgart team and signed with BMW Motorsport, joining Andy Priaulx and Augusto Farfus.  Bruno is the 3rd driver to be confirmed for the BMW factory teams, which will field 6 cars in the 2012 DTM series.</p>
<p>BMW will be represented in the DTM by three factory teams, BMW Team Schnitzer, BMW Team RBM and BMW Team RMG.  Each team will enter two of BMW&#8217;s M3 DTM cars, shown for the first time in its BMW M Performance livery at last weekend&#8217;s season finale in Hockenheim.</p>
<p><img src="http://www.skiddmark.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/10/DTM-2012-I4.jpg" alt="2012 DTM Contenders" /><span class="All three manufacturers competing in the 2012 DTM series ran demonstration laps of their new cars at last weekend's DTM finale."></span></p>
<p>Spengler made his debut in the DTM in 2005, and has made a solid impression on the series. The 28-year-old has been on the top step of the podium nine times in 74 starts. In addition, the French-Canadian has claimed 11 pole positions and set 12 fastest laps to date. Twice – in 2006 and 2007 – Spengler narrowly missed out on the DTM title, ending up second in the drivers’ classification on each occasion. In 2011 he finished third overall for Mercedes-Benz. </p>
<p>“In recent weeks we have not only been developing the BMW M3 DTM, but have also been working on the driver line-up for our return to the DTM,” says BMW Motorsport Director Jens Marquardt. </p>
<p><span style="text-align:center; display: block;"><a href="http://skiddmark.com/2011/10/bruno-spengler-switches-from-amg-mercedes-to-drive-for-bmw-in-the-2012-dtm-series/"><img src="http://img.youtube.com/vi/yEr41qrWXmI/2.jpg" alt="" /></a></span><span class="The demo drive of the 2012 DTM Contenders at Hockenheim last weekend.  Source: DTV.tv"></span></p>
<p>“Outside our current line-up, Bruno Spengler was one of our top choices. Despite his youth he has a lot of DTM experience, which will greatly assist us during our development phase and on race weekends. For this reason, we did not hesitate when the opportunity to sign Bruno up arose. We have yet to decide which of our three teams he will drive for. That will be announced at a later stage.”</p>
<p>Spengler initially made his name in Formula Renault and Formula 3 before making his debut in the DTM in 2005. He scored his first points with a sixth place at the Lausitzring (DE) and went on to claim his first win at the Norisring (DE) a year later. He followed up that victory with his first pole position at the Nürburgring (DE). He has since developed into one of the top drivers in this series.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>In 1978, Director Claude Lelouch produced a 10 minute short-film called <a href="http://www.skiddplayer.com/video/44/christmas-competition-win-a-ni" title="C'etait un Rendezvous">C&#8217;était un Rendezvous (&#8220;It was a date&#8221;)</a> , showing a high speed drive through the streets of Paris. </p>
<p>The sequence was filmed by a camera mounted on the bumper of a Mercedes-Benz 450SEL 6.9, then dubbed with the sound of Lelouch&#8217;s Ferrari 275GTB.  The rest as they say is history.</p>
<p>33 years later, Lamborghini have used the theme of C&#8217;était un Rendezvous to promote their latest model, the Gallardo LP570-4 Super Trofeo Stradale unveiled at the Frankfurt Motor Show last month.  </p>
<p><span style="text-align:center; display: block;"><a href="http://skiddmark.com/2011/10/lamborghini-remakes-cetait-un-rendezvous-to-promote-the-new-super-trofeo-stradale-wvideo/"><img src="http://img.youtube.com/vi/IBbqrHQKOQc/2.jpg" alt="" /></a></span><span class="news-caption"></span></p>
<p>The film, &#8220;SUPER TROFEO STRADALE. LIFE IS A RACE.&#8221; was produced by creative agency, Philipp &#038; Keuntje GmbH, and Final Touch Filmproduktion GmbH and features a Super Trofeo Stradle driving through the city streets accompanied by the sound of that wonderful 562bhp 5.2-litre V10 engine.  </p>
<p><img src="http://www.skiddmark.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/10/SuperTrofeoStradale-lifeisarace_I1.jpg" alt="Super Trofeo Stradale. Life is a race." /></p>
<p>At nearly two and a half minutes long, it&#8217;s somewhat shorter than Lelouch&#8217;s 9 minute original, but the message is clear &#8211; if life is a race, then the best car to experience it in is the Gallardo Super Trofeo Stradale.  </p>
<p>It&#8217;s not the first time someone has either used C&#8217;était un Rendezvous as inspiration for a film or commercial, or made a homage of their own.  In the following scene we see a Porsche 911 GT3 and Lamborghini Gallardo Superleggera dicing it out through the streets of Paris, inspired by the original film:</p>
<p><span style="text-align:center; display: block;"><a href="http://skiddmark.com/2011/10/lamborghini-remakes-cetait-un-rendezvous-to-promote-the-new-super-trofeo-stradale-wvideo/"><img src="http://img.youtube.com/vi/-PW-lTWxDP0/2.jpg" alt="" /></a></span><span class="news-caption">This short film is reminiscent of the iconic C&#8217;était un Rendezvous and features a Porsche 911 GT3 and Lamborghini Gallardo Superleggera.</span></p>
<p>The agency responsible for this latest film, Philipp &#038; Keuntje GmbH, were also behind my favourite poster ads EVER, <em>Lamborghini: A part of Italy.</em>  Take a look at them below and then tell me those aren&#8217;t amonsgst the most emotive car ads you&#8217;ve ever seen..</p>
<p><span class="news-caption"><img src="http://www.skiddmark.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/10/lambo-partofitaly_I3.jpg" alt="Lamborghini. A part of Italy." /></span><br />
<span class="news-caption"><img src="http://www.skiddmark.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/10/lambo-partofitaly_I2.jpg" alt="Lamborghini. A part of Italy." /></span><br />
<span class="news-caption"><img src="http://www.skiddmark.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/10/lambo-partofitaly_I1.jpg" alt="Lamborghini. A part of Italy." /></span></p>
<h2>Gallardo LP570-4 Super Trofeo Stradale</h2>
<p>The Super Trofeo Stradale is based technically on the 562 bhp Gallardo Superleggera, but it’s not just the performance which is impressive, Lamborghini have gone to the trouble of ‘tuning’ the V10’s firing order to deliver the same spine-tingling sound you hear in the Super Trofeo motor racing series.</p>
<p>Generous use of carbon fibre enables the Gallardo LP 570-4 Super Trofeo Stradale to boast a dry weight of 1340 kg &#8211; that’s 70 kg less than the already lean Gallardo LP 560-4, and gives the Gallardo LP 570-4 Super Trofeo Stradale a power-to-weight ratio of 419 bhp/tonne. Performance is suitably supercar-quick with a 0 to 62 mph in 3.4 seconds and 125 mph in just 13.8 seconds, with maximum speed a cool 200 mph (320 Km/h).</p>
<p><img class="reflected" src="/wp-content/uploads/2011/08/634x392xGallardo-Super-Trofeo-Stradale_banner.jpg.pagespeed.ic.a_YGCooQed.jpg" alt="Frankfurt 2011: Lamborghini Gallardo LP 570-4 Super Trofeo Stradale" width="634" height="392" style="display: block; border-top-width: 0px; border-right-width: 0px; border-bottom-width: 0px; border-left-width: 0px; border-style: initial; border-color: initial; "></p>
<p>The Gallardo Super Trofeo Stradale sports a brand new “Rosso Mars” paint finish that underscores the special connection between ultimate race track performance and Lamborghini’s “Italian-ness”. The “Rosso Mars” colour symbolises Italy’s traditional racing red with a modern 21st century touch.</p>
<p>In contrast to the “Rosso Mars” finish Matte Black is used on the large rear spoiler, the engine hood and the front air intakes. The forged wheels are painted in high-gloss black, a colour that is also available on the roof as an option. The rocker panel covers, impressive rear diffuser and outside mirror housings are also made of carbon fibre polished to a high gloss, while the brake callipers are accented in red for the first time on a Lamborghini.</p>
<p><img class="reflected"  src="/wp-content/uploads/2011/08/xGallardo-Super-Trofeo-Stradale_I1.jpg.pagespeed.ic.i7cdS686eI.jpg" alt="Gallardo Super Trofeo Stradale - Interior" width="634" height="392"></p>
<p>Besides the historically suggestive “Rosso Mars”, the new Gallardo Super Trofeo Stradale is also available upon request in “Grigio Telesto” or “Bianco Monocerus” with the roof available in gloss black as an option.</p>
<p>With such a strong racing connection, Lamborghini are also offering the LP 570-4 Super Trofeo Stradale with a tubular interior roll cage, 4-point safety belts and a fire extinguisher. However if you’ve buying one for ‘show’ more so than ‘go’, you can still equip it with satellite navigation, a Bluetooth connection for mobile phones, an anti-theft system, and a front-axle lifting system for those annoying speed bumps and parking garages.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Next season&#8217;s DTM series promises to be a classic, as BMW join Mercedes and Audi on track for the first time since 1995.  For the DTM season finale at Hockenheim today, the contenders met for the first time in a friendly demonstration for the fans.</p>
<p>BMW works driver Dirk Werner completed two laps of the Hockenheim track in the “BMW M Performance Accessories M3 DTM”, with eight-time Le Mans winner Tom Kristensen joining him in the new 2012 Audi A5 DTM.</p>
<p>Audi&#8217;s Hans-Jürgen Abt spoke about his enthusiasm for the 2012 season, &#8220;I’m already looking forward to a new era in the DTM. Continuing with the new cars for Audi and meeting with BMW as another competitor is a huge challenge. For the team as well it’s a huge task. It has to sort itself anew with the new technology. </p>
<p><img src="http://www.skiddmark.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/10/audi_A5DTM_I1.jpg" alt="Audi A5 DTM" /><span class="news-caption">2012 Audi A5 DTM driven by Tom Kristensen</span></p>
<p>I know that I’ve got a tremendous squad. I look forward to us taking on the competition. That has always been our strength, particularly at the beginning of such a new era. We’ll let ourselves be surprised.&#8221;</p>
<p>BMW Motorsport Director Jens Marquardt said: “This event was something very special for us. Since the early morning there have been clusters of people around our car, and it was simply breathtaking to be able to present our car in front of such a crowd. </p>
<p>The reactions to our car were all positive. Today gave us all a lot of extra motivation to present ourselves in top form in half a year’s time at the same venue.” </p>
<p><span style="text-align:center; display: block;"><a href="http://skiddmark.com/2011/10/the-2012-dtm-contenders-come-out-to-play-at-hockenheim/"><img src="http://img.youtube.com/vi/yEr41qrWXmI/2.jpg" alt="" /></a></span><span class="Demo drive of the 2012 DTM Contenders at Hockenheim.  Source: DTV.tv"></span></p>
<p>Fitted with a powerful new V8 engine generating approximately 480 bhp, the M3 DTM accelerates from 0 to 62 mph in a little over three seconds and has a theoretical top speed of nearly 190 mph.</p>
<p>BMW works driver Dirk Werner commented: “It was a great experience to be able to do today’s demonstration laps. Obviously I drove the BMW M3 DTM at the recent tests – but a stage like this really is something special. You could feel the spine tingling atmosphere even in the car.” </p>
<p><img src="http://www.skiddmark.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/10/M3DTM_I1.jpg" alt="BMW M3 DTM" /><span class="news-caption">2012 BMW M3 DTM which was driven by Dirk Werner at Hockenheim today</span></p>
<p>The new “BMW M Performance Accessories” livery of the BMW M3 DTM had been presented to a few members of the public at the BMW Autohaus Krauth in Heidelberg (DE) on Friday. </p>
<p>Around three months earlier, on July 15th, the BMW M3 DTM concept car was officially presented at the BMW Welt in Munich (DE). From 2012 on, BMW will compete in the DTM with three strong teams, the BMW Team Schnitzer, the BMW Team RBM and the BMW Team RMG. The BMW works drivers Andy Priaulx (GB) and Augusto Farfus (BR) have already been confirmed as drivers for the 2012 season. </p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Although the 2011 DTM driver&#8217;s championship has already been clinched by Audi&#8217;s Martin Tomczyk, the team title is still up for grabs with Audi Sport Team Abt Sportsline leading by just 5 points (77 pts) over THOMAS SABO / Mercedes-Benz Bank AMG (72 pts).  There&#8217;s also the consolation prize of &#8216;Vice-Champion&#8217; to be decided, which will go to either Mercedes&#8217; Bruno Spengler (51 pts) or Audi&#8217;s Mattias Ekström (49 pts).</p>
<p>The DTM finale takes place this coming weekend (October 23rd) at the Hockenheimring and with the regulations changing for 2012, Mercedes has chosen to remind us of their rich and illustrious history in the series, by sharing some images below.  </p>
<p>Since 2000, when the DTM series was revived, Mercedes-Benz have won 18 out of the 25 races staged at Hockenheim, which is a win rate of over 70 percent.  But Audi&#8217;s A4 DTM is none too shabby either &#8211; 43 pole positions, 31 fastest race laps, 34 victories and five champion’s titles since its debut in April 2004 at Hockenheim.  </p>
<p>Spengler said, &#8220;The Hockenheimring is one of my favourite tracks, and the season opener in May went really well for us – it was the second win in my career at the circuit. I especially like the combination of fast corners and slow sections such as the hairpin. This course is technically very demanding and you need good brakes and impressive top speed. It’s a lot of fun racing here. As this is the last race for the DTM AMG Mercedes C-Class, we’re aiming to send our fans home happy with a victory and to win the team championship.”</p>
<p>Audi Sport driver Mattias Ekström spoke of his thoughts before the weekend, &#8220;It’s always nice to travel to Hockenheim. It will conclude the season. This time I’m arriving there completely relaxed and will try to deliver a solid performance. I want to clinch another good result before we can look forward to the winter break and the tests with the new A5 DTM.&#8221;</p>
<p>So, the gloves are off for what should be a stunning season finale, which will be made even more special by the first display of all 2012 championship contenders on track at the same time &#8211; the Audi A5 DTM, the BMW M3 DTM and the DTM AMG Mercedes C-Coupé will all take to the racetrack for some demonstration laps, providing fans with their first taste of what to expect in 2012.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Following our recent interview with Caterham&#8217;s CEO, Ansar Ali &#8211; <a href="http://www.skiddmark.com/2011/09/16/behind-the-scenes-at-caterham-cars/" title="Behind the scenes at Caterham Cars"><em>Behind the scenes at Caterham Cars</em></a> &#8211; the company has now confirmed details of its programme to develop the next iconic Caterham models.</p>
<p>The programme will be owned by a new standalone engineering business, Caterham Technology and Innovation Limited (CTI), which will be responsible for the development of a completely new line of accessible and affordable sportscars.  Inspired by the lightweight, minimalist philosophy of the Seven and drawing on the advanced technologies and materials from the Group’s Team Lotus Formula One and Caterham Team AirAsia GP2 motorsport operations, CTI will also undertake advanced projects for external companies operating within the automotive and aerospace sectors.</p>
<p>&#8220;The new shareholders are committed to investing in an exciting range of global products over the next 10 years,&#8221; says Mark Edwards, CTI&#8217;s Chief Executive. &#8220;Tony Fernandes has been very clear from the start that Caterham needed a sustainable research and development business model in order to meet the plans the management have for the road car business. </p>
<p>“By establishing unique operating principles for CTI, we have managed to attract a world-class team of niche vehicle engineers eager to build on the ethos of Caterham and the DNA of the Seven.” </p>
<p>Among the first in a series of respected industry figures to join the new operation will be <strong>Tony Shute.</strong> Joining as Head of Road Cars for the new business and, as an avid motorsport competitor in his own right, Shute is credited with bringing the ground-breaking Series 1 Lotus Elise to market.</p>
<p>“When the opportunity to be involved with creating the next iconic Caterham arose, I couldn&#8217;t turn it down,” says Shute. &#8220;The core principles and ambitions of CTI have enabled us to attract some of the brightest and most respected talents in their fields.” </p>
<p>Further announcements will be made in due course. </p>
<p>The new business will focus on unique vehicle architectures, high performance engines, advanced materials and manufacturing technologies in association with the Formula One and GP2 race teams. </p>
<p><div class="columns twothirds " ><div><img src="http://www.skiddmark.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/05/caterham-greenyellow_I11.jpg" alt="Ansar Ali" /></div></div> <div class="columns onethird last clearfix " ><div>
<p>Speaking of Caterham Technology and Innovation, Caterham Cars’ Chief Executive, Ansar Ali, says: “Creating a new product range that has the same reputation and appeal as the Seven, which delivers on the promise of accessibility and affordability, is the Holy Grail in this business. To meet the challenge, we knew we needed to invest in a new operation that would have the scope, experience and vision to deliver.”</p>
<p></div></div><div class="clear"></div> </p>
<p>He adds: “I feel very confident that our customers will be very pleased with the products I have challenged CTI to deliver, in addition to supporting the Seven and I look forward to revealing our plans in more detail soon.”</p>
<p>Caterham has announced that its new CTI operation will be based in Norfolk near the Group’s motorsport operations, and within spitting distance of Lotus Car&#8217;s headquarters in Hethel. </p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>News of Lotus&#8217; entry in the GT category of the FIA Rally Championship in 2012, got me thinking about the relationship between road and rally cars and whether we, the customer, are still benefiting from the participation of car manufacturers in the sport.  </p>
<p>Rallying has had a long and close association with road cars, perhaps more so than any other form of motorsport, but the approachability of today&#8217;s WRC owes much to the sport&#8217;s blackest day 25 years ago.</p>
<h2>Group B</h2>
<p>In 1986 the great Finnish rally driver Henry Toivonen and his co-driver Sergio Cresto were leading in the World Rally Championship when their Lancia Delta S4 Group B car left the road and plunged down a hillside. The petrol tanks ruptured and it’s assumed that the combination of fuel and a red-hot turbocharger ignited the car and set fire to the surrounding undergrowth. </p>
<p>By the time rescue workers made it to the remote spot (some 30 minutes later) all that remained of the car was a blackened body shell with the remains of Toivonen and co-driver Sergio Cresto still inside.  </p>
<p>This tragedy, and the deaths of other drivers in these powerful ‘supercars’ signalled the end of the short but turbulent Group B era.  </p>
<p>Group B was established in 1982 to provide manufacturers with the opportunity to chase rally victories and thus promote their brand by building cars for the purpose instead of adapting &#8216;compromised&#8217; mass production cars. It gave birth to legendary cars such as the Lancia Delta S4, Audi Quattro S1, Peugeot 205 T16, Ford RS200 and the MG Metro 6R4; cars unobtainable to most spectators and probably just as well. </p>
<p><img src="http://www.skiddmark.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/09/road2rally_I2.jpg" alt="Group B monsters" /></p>
<p>With little in the way of homologation rules, these monsters often produced over 600 bhp and could accelerate from rest to 100 mph in just a few seconds.  It was an insanely dangerous time.</p>
<p>The problem for the spectators, and the sport in general, was that rally cars were pretty much unrecognisable from those that ordinary fans could buy.  Group A cars which had previously dominated the series, were modified versions of the cars the punters bought, whereas manufacturers were only obliged to build 200 cars to enter Group B and in many cases didn&#8217;t even achieve that.  </p>
<p>Back in the mid-80s you could pay upwards of £50,000 for a road-going version of these Group B supercars, which to put in perspective compares with the £37,000 Ferrari asked for its V8-engined Mondial 3.2 QV at the time. </p>
<h2>Production car rallying</h2>
<p>Following the madness that was Group B, the sport settled down until 1997 saw the introduction of the definitive World Rally Car (WRC) that we know today. These vehicles had to be derived from a production car with a minimum production run of 2500 units.  </p>
<p>Obviously, some modifications were allowed notably upgrades to the transmission, suspension and engine but the rules were tightly controlled and we were watching cars which ultimately we could buy in the showroom &#8211; albeit with considerably more creature comforts.</p>
<p><img src="http://www.skiddmark.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/09/road2rally_I3.jpg" alt="Subaru Impreza versus Mitsubishi Evo" /></p>
<p>It was during this period when the rally icons &#8211; Subaru&#8217;s Impreza and Mitsubishi Lancer EVO &#8211; were born.  We celebrated the performances of Colin McRae, Richard Burns, Tommi Mäkinen and Carlos Sainz.  </p>
<p>However as costs escalated and Super 2000 rules were introduced, both Mitsubishi and Subaru became less competitive and eventually dropped out of the world stage. As the road cars appeared less on our TV screens, so their appeal waned with buyers, sales then dropped and now they&#8217;re future looks very much in doubt.  </p>
<p>Mitsubishi initially stated that the Evo series would be discontinued, due to it being out of step with the company&#8217;s new environmental focus and Subaru remain quiet about future hot Impreza models, especially if their old sparring partner is no longer up for the fight.</p>
<p><img src="http://www.skiddmark.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/09/road2rally_I4.jpg" alt="FIA IRC cars" /></p>
<p>But perhaps all is not lost.  The face of rallying is different these days, with Ford, Citroen, Skoda and now MINI grabbing our attention.  They remain just as closely linked with road cars as ever and the new S2000 rules should see more manufacturers entering the scene. </p>
<p>VW group now run a very successful works team of Skoda Fabia’s in the Intercontinental Rally Challenge and in the next couple of years they’ll be fielding another works team, this time in the WRC, using a version of the ever popular Polo. These cars aren’t so far away from the mainstream Fabia vRS and Polo GTI that we can buy ourselves.</p>
<p>Which brings us back to Lotus and its Exige R-GT.</p>
<h2>GT Category</h2>
<p>In Lotus&#8217; announcement at the Frankfurt motor show last week they stated that the R-GT will participate in the newly formed FIA GT category of the FIA Rally Championship, on the asphalt events in Monte Carlo, Tour de Corse and San Remo.  </p>
<p><img src="http://www.skiddmark.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/09/road2rally_I1.jpg" alt="Lotus Exige R-GT" /></p>
<p>Apparently FIA President, Jean Todt, asked Lotus Director of Motorsport, Claudio Berro to work with his counterparts at Aston Martin and Porsche to devise a set of global rules for a GT category of rallying.  GT Rallying is already popular in France, Belgium, Germany and Italy, but each championship runs under different rules.  Todt would like to unite these into a world championship event and bring some glamour back into the sport.</p>
<p>This all brings back memories of when the Porsche 911, Renault Alpine, Lancia Stratos and Lancia 037 were all competing in international rallies and Todt can envisage cars such as the Alfa Romeo 4C, the rumoured Renault Alpine and even Nissan&#8217;s GT-R becoming a common sight on both tarmac and gravel events in the World Rally Championship. </p>
<p>Presently Berro believes the Exige R-GT would be about “..1.5 secs slower per kilometre than a Super2000 car but on some stages, like asphalt, we could, for sure, be quicker.”  Lotus are pricing the R-GT at around £100,000 plus local taxes &#8211; considerably less than the £500,000 necessary for a top-line WRC contender &#8211; so the GT category could become a more accessible route into WRC for privateer teams.</p>
<h2>The future</h2>
<p>Motor racing is an important avenue of research for manufacturers. Formula 1 might be a fantastic spectator sport but the cars are designed with one purpose in mind &#8211; to win &#8211; and bear litte similarity to road cars beyond the 4 round black things which make contact with the road. </p>
<p>But more than any other form of motorsport, the link between competition and mainstream road cars is clearest in rallying.  </p>
<p>For 2011/2 rally rules have changed yet again, partly to reduce costs and will return to using mechanical sequential gearshifts and mechanical diffs, whilst engines will drop in size to use 1.6-litre turbocharged units.</p>
<p><img src="http://www.skiddmark.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/09/road2rally_I5.jpg" alt="Nissan GT-R in the Targa Tasmania" /></p>
<p>Just as paddle shift controls and electronic differentials have filtering down into our road cars, so will developments such as hybrid powerplants and energy recuperation (KERS) be accelerated by their use in rally cars.  </p>
<p>So let&#8217;s welcome Lotus and look forward to seeing Alfa Romeo, Nissan and even Porsche join the World Rally scene &#8211; rallying leads to better road cars, it&#8217;s in their genes.</p>
